Transaction 5193eff070541dd17b40f39a022a9600feab44858653765895dbff3f7c29422a
1 Input
1 Output
-
5193eff070541dd17b40f39a022a9600feab44858653765895dbff3f7c29422a:0
- value
- 18981835
- script pubkey
- OP_0 OP_PUSHBYTES_20 178a87933f2f5a5c1f9f2cc34f8eedb6db7c034c
- address
- ltc1qz79g0yel9ad9c8ul9np5lrhdkmdhcq6vdwh08t